Gyros Casserole with Feta Baking Steps

Step 1: Marinate and Sear the Meat

Combine the meat with:
  • Gyro seasoning
  • Olive oil

Let the meat marinate for 30 minutes.

Heat a pan over medium heat and sear the meat until it develops a beautiful golden-brown crust.

Add chopped onions, minced garlic, and diced bell peppers, cooking everything together for about 5 minutes until the vegetables soften and become slightly caramelized.

Step 2: Whip Up the Creamy Sauce

In a mixing bowl, blend together:
  • Heavy cream
  • Sour cream
  • Paprika
  • Dried oregano
  • Thyme
  • Salt
  • Black pepper

Stir until the sauce is smooth and well-combined, creating a rich and tangy base for the casserole.

Step 3: Create the Casserole Base

Grease a baking dish with a light coating of oil or butter.

Spread the seared meat and vegetable mixture evenly across the bottom of the dish.

Pour the creamy sauce over the meat, gently stirring to ensure everything is well-coated.

Step 4: Top and Bake the Casserole

Generously sprinkle:
  • Crumbled feta cheese
  • Shredded cheese

Over the top of the casserole.

Place in a preheated oven at 400°F and bake for 20-25 minutes until the cheese melts and turns a beautiful golden brown with crispy edges.

Step 5: Garnish and Serve

Remove the casserole from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es.

Garnish with freshly chopped herbs like parsley or dill.

Serve alongside a cool tzatziki sauce for a complete Mediterranean-inspired meal that’s sure to impress.

Gyros Casserole Storage Guide

  • Store leftover gyros casserole in an airtight container for up to 3-4 days in the refrigerator.
  • Pack cooled casserole in freezer-safe containers, keeping it fresh for 2-3 months. Wrap tightly to prevent freezer burn.
  • Warm refrigerated casserole at 350°F for 15-20 minutes, covering with foil to prevent drying out. Remove foil last 5 minutes to crisp cheese.
  • Reheat individual portions on medium power for 1-2 minutes, stirring halfway through to distribute heat evenly. Add splash of cream to maintain moisture.

Ingredients

Scale

Protein:

  • 1 lb (500 g) pork or chicken strips

Seasonings and Herbs:

  • 2 tablespoons gyro se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on paprika (sweet)
  • 1/2 teaspoon o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Vegetables and Dairy:

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 onion, sliced into rings
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 green bell pepper, sliced
  • 3/4 cup (200 ml) heavy cream
  • 3/4 cup (200 g) sour cream or creme fraiche
  • 5 ounces (150 g) feta cheese, crumbled
  • 3.5 ounces (100 g) shredded cheese (e.g., Gouda or Mozzarella)

Instructions

  1. Transform the tender meat by massaging it with aromatic gyro seasoning and extra virgin olive oil, allowing the flavors to meld for a minimum of half an hour.
  2. Activate a skillet over medium flame and expertly sear the marinated meat until achieving a rich, caramelized exterior with deep brown edges.
  3. Introduce chopped onions, minced garlic, and vibrant bell peppers to the skillet, sautéing until the vegetables soften and release their natural sweetness.
  4. Craft a luxurious sauce by whisking together velvety heavy cream, tangy sour cream, smoky paprika, earthy oregano, delicate thyme, and a precise balance of salt and pepper.
  5. Prepare a baking vessel with a light coating of oil, then artfully distribute the spiced meat and vegetable medley across the surface.
  6. Cascade the creamy sauce over the meat mixture, gently incorporating to ensure even distribution of flavors.
  7. Generously crown the dish with crumbled feta and shredded cheese, creating a tempting golden blanket.
  8. Slide the casserole into a preheated oven set at 400°F, allowing it to transform for 20-25 minutes until the cheese melts into a bubbling, golden masterpiece.
  9. Remove from the oven and let the casserole rest briefly, allowing flavors to settle and intensify.
  10. Garnish with fresh herbs and accompany with a cooling tzatziki, presenting a Mediterranean-inspired culinary experience.
